ISLAMABAD :             To honour the winners of Asian Junior Squash Team Championship, a prize distribution ceremony was held at Serena Hotels Islamabad.       Air Chief Marshal Mujahid Anwar Khan, Chief of the Air Staff, Pakistan Air Force, who is also President Pakistan Squash Federation was the Chief Guest at the occasion. He awarded cash prizes to the players, who won gold medal in the recently held Championship at Pattaya (Thailand). The Pakistan team comprising Farhan Hashmi, Abbas Zeb, Haris Qasim and Hamza Khan performed exceptionally well in the Championship, earning Pakistan the coveted title after 6 years.

Addressing at the occasion, the Air Chief said that we are proud of our young players who brought laurels to the country by winning the prestigious championship. He added that the last two years remained great for the Pakistan Squash as we won a total of 58 medals including 27 Gold, 13 Silver and 18 Bronze medals at national and international levels. He appreciated the hard work put in by the coaching staff for providing international standard training and coaching facilities to the young players. He also lauded the efforts of Pakistan Squash Federation in making concerted efforts for bringing back the lost glory in the game of Squash.
